The relevant error was:
---
Updating fontconfig cache for /usr/share/fonts/truetype/unfonts
No CIDSupplement specified for Batang-Bold,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for UMingCN,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for KochiGothic-Regular-JaH,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for Dotum-Bold,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for KochiMincho-Regular,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for KochiGothic-Regular,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for KochiMincho-Regular-JaH,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for Dotum-Regular, defaulting to 0.
No CIDSupplement specified for Batang-Regular, defaulting to 0.
Segmentation fault
dpkg: error processing ttf-unfonts-core (--configure):
 subprocess post-installation script returned error exit status 139

This kind of error is likely due to a corrupted memory. If it happens frequently you should run the "Memory check" from the boot menu. If that runs successfully, please start the rescue system in the boot menu and select the "File system check" option in the next menu
